A 3 Hop Hen

Let’s have a farm adventure in kindergarten - learning about hens, igniting creativity and practicing some essential fine motor skills for early writing. Spring is in the air, and it's time to bring the animals into the classroom! Drawing hens with colorful crayons is a fun and educational activity that will help kindergarteners learn about the farm and give you the opportunity to display some gorgeous happy artworks in your classroom. 

hen drawing

Materials:

  • Colorful crayons
  • White paper
  • Watercolors or other pains (I use watercolors a lot with little learners, not to necessarily teach watercolor technique but because the palette is ready-to-go and tidying up is quick and easy)

Instructions:

  • Begin by reminding students how to hold a crayon correctly.
  • Demonstrate how to draw a simple hen shape with a hop of 3 for each section (see my brief Instagram REEL).
  • Students draw the body with 3 hops, then the comb with another 3 and finish with the body shape, adding 3 little hops for the tail feathers. Students can complete their hen with legs and additional detail of their choice.
  • Provide a variety of shades of pink, yellow, purple, and blue crayons for the hens' bodies and other colors for a background and fun detail.
  • Let students choose their favorite colors and experiment with different shades.
  • Once students have drawn their hens, encourage them to add their own creative touches.
  • They can add details like a bumblebee hovering over the hen or a chick peeking out from under its wing.

Extension Ideas:

To extend the learning experience, you can ask students to:
  • Write a short story about their hen.
  • Create a farm scene by adding other animals and elements to their drawings.
  • Research different breeds of hens and share their findings with the class.
